Objective
It is able to tamp three sleepers per tamping cycle. The tamping unit
is divided into sections so that it is possible to switch over to single
sleeper tamping at any time.
Unimat (switch) Tamping Unit
This unit has four side tilting tamping tines. By additional lateral
displacement of the tamping units in the machine frame, it is
possible to tamp the entire switch, including the frog area.
Connecting track or station tracks can also be tamped.
Working Principle of Tamping Unit
• Tamping unit are made to vibrate using eccentric
shaft rotated by hydraulic motor at frequency of 35hz
makes the ballast as semi fluid results in easy
penetration of tool up to the required depth and packs
the ballast under sleeper on non synchronous equal
pressure.
• Non synchronous equal pressure is a concept in
which pressure is applied equally by all cylinders to
the tamping tools with allowing them to move
independently according to the resistance offered by
the ballast.
• Tamping depth has great influence in packing of
ballast, if the depth exceeds or shorten than the
optimum value perfect tamping can’t be achieved.

Assembling of vibration shaft with bearing
Bearings are fixed in vibration shaft by heating the inner race at 900 C
Fixing of Vibration Shaft
Fix the vibration shaft in bank an tight all the bolts of bearing housing
using lopcktite 222 at the torque of 40 Nm
Checking of Main Bearing Clearance
Check oil leakage from main oil seal by rotating vib. Shaft at 2200 RPM for the
period of two hrs.
Fixing of Bearing in Small male Squeezing
Cylinder
Fix the NJ2216, NJP 2216 bearing in Small male Squeezing Cylinder with
bearing housing 2E-22-11.tight the cover plate by bolts at 40 Nm using
locktite 222E.
Fixing of Bearing in Small female Squeezing
Cylinder
Fix the NJ219 bearings in Cylinder with the cover plate by bolts at
40 Nm using locktite 222E.
Hanging of Small Squeezing Cylinder
Fix the inner races of bearings of the squeezing cylinders on the vibration shaft
after heating it at 900C & insert all the squeezing cylinders.
Fixing of Steel Bush NJ219 with
inner race
Heat the steel bush to 900 c with bearing inner race and insert in the
vibration shaft.
